An accessible and straightforward sewing technique, it’s a great for adding patterns and shapes to everything from patchwork to clothing and cushions. learn how to use your embroidery machine to sew an applique design. in essence, appliqué means sewing a piece of fabric (usually a shape) onto another piece of cloth. the key to successful applique is knowing which type of stitching works best for your project. sew around the appliqué using your sewing machine. A simple straight stitch will work for most designs, but you can also use a blanket stitch, a zigzag stitch, a decorative stitch, or even a satin stitch if you want to be fancier.
